Lakshmikumaran & Sridharan, India’s fifth-largest law firm, has grown its corporate practice with the addition of partner Ashwin Mathew in Mumbai.

Mathew, who joins from boutique Mansukhlal Hiralal & Company, has over two decades of experience. He advises on corporate/commercial law, including investments, financing, acquisitions, joint ventures and general corporate advisory work.

“Ashwin’s experience and skillset dovetail well with the firm’s existing capabilities to further deepen our corporate and financing practice in Mumbai,” said V. Lakshmikumaran, managing partner of L&S, in a statement. “With strong focus on deep research and excellent drafting and client management skills, we look forward to building a robust team under him in Mumbai.”

With the addition of Mathew, the firm now has 48 partners nationally.
